Orion Sun Partner: Understanding the Relationship, Value, and Collaboration

Overview of the Orion Sun Partner Relationship

The Orion Sun Partner program is designed to align platform capabilities with ecosystem collaborators to drive shared value across cloud, AI, and infrastructure initiatives. This relationship framework typically involves joint solution development, co-marketing, and technical integration support that enables partners to accelerate delivery and broaden market reach. By establishing clear governance, communication channels, and success metrics, the program aims to create repeatable playbooks that scale while preserving partner autonomy. The following sections detail program structure, roles, eligibility, benefits, and practical steps to maximize outcomes within this collaboration model.

Program Objectives and Strategic Intent

Orion Sun Partner strategy centers on three primary goals: expanding platform adoption, deepening technical specialization, and strengthening joint go-to-market motions. The program seeks to identify partners whose solutions complement Orion Sun’s core offerings, creating a portfolio of interoperable products and services. Through shared roadmaps, co-innovation sprints, and aligned KPIs, the relationship targets sustainable revenue growth and measurable customer outcomes. Emphasis is placed on transparency, long-term planning, and continuous feedback loops to adapt to evolving market conditions.

Strategic Pillars

  • Platform Integration: Enable seamless connectivity between Orion Sun services and partner solutions.
  • Revenue Synergy: Develop joint pricing, packaging, and incentive structures that reward collaboration.
  • Customer Outcomes: Focus on use-case-driven implementations that demonstrate clear ROI.

Eligibility and Onboarding Process

Orion Sun Partner programs typically target technology vendors, system integrators, and independent software vendors with proven delivery capabilities. Eligibility criteria often include technical competency assessments, compliance with security and data governance standards, and alignment with Orion Sun’s market segments. The onboarding workflow usually involves an application review, reference checks, a technical validation phase, and formal agreement signing. During this phase, partners gain access to documentation, sandbox environments, and dedicated onboarding specialists to ensure readiness.

Benefits and Value Proposition

Orion Sun Partner collaboration is structured to deliver mutual upside through co-sell opportunities, shared learning, and joint product innovation. Partners often benefit from marketing funds, lead sharing arrangements, and prioritized technical support. In turn, Orion Sun gains expanded distribution, deeper domain expertise, and faster iteration on feature requests sourced from real-world deployments. The relationship is designed to be asymmetric in effort but symmetric in outcome, where both parties experience compounding advantages as the partnership matures.

Value Drivers

  • Joint Solution Development: Co-build offerings tailored to vertical or functional needs.
  • Co-Marketing and Events: Shared campaigns, webinars, and customer workshops.
  • Technical Enablement: Access to APIs, SDKs, and engineering consultations.

Governance and Communication Framework

Effective Orion Sun Partner relationships rely on structured governance with clearly defined roles, escalation paths, and review cadences. Typically, a partnership committee oversees strategic decisions, while working groups handle operational tasks such as integration testing, issue resolution, and performance reporting. Communication protocols often include monthly business reviews, quarterly strategic sessions, and ad-hoc technical syncs as needed. Documented playbooks ensure continuity and clarity, reducing friction during personnel changes or market shifts.

Governance Components

Component Description Frequency
Business Review Performance review against joint KPIs and market progress Monthly or Quarterly
Technical Sync Integration testing, API updates, and issue triage Biweekly or As Needed
Strategy Session Roadmap alignment, new opportunity identification Quarterly

Risk Management and Conflict Resolution

Even well-designed Orion Sun Partner arrangements can encounter misalignment in expectations, resource constraints, or competitive dynamics. Proactive risk management includes scenario planning, clear documentation of assumptions, and predefined fallback positions. When conflicts arise, the program typically follows a tiered resolution process: initial discussion between account teams, escalation to governance committees, and, if necessary, formal mediation led by executive sponsors. Maintaining a transparent issue log and joint action plans helps preserve trust and ensures timely resolution.

Measuring Success and Continuous Improvement

Success in Orion Sun Partner engagements is evaluated through a blend of quantitative metrics and qualitative signals. Key performance indicators often include joint revenue, customer win rates, time-to-integration, and customer satisfaction scores. Regular retrospectives allow partners to refine playbooks, adjust incentive structures, and incorporate lessons learned. By institutionalizing measurement and fostering a culture of continuous improvement, the relationship remains adaptive and resilient to shifts in technology and demand.
